What are Softboard Panels?

Softboard panels are typically manufactured from wood fibers, often recycled or sustainably sourced, that are compressed and bonded together. This process creates a lightweight yet durable material with excellent sound absorption capabilities. Unlike traditional hard surfaces that reflect sound, softboard panels absorb sound waves, reducing reverberation and improving overall acoustics. The density and thickness of the panel directly influence its sound absorption coefficient; thicker, denser panels generally perform better. The use of natural fibers also contributes to the eco-friendliness of softboard panel solutions.

Key Benefits of Using Softboard Panels

The advantages of using softboard panels extend beyond just acoustics. Here are some of the primary benefits:

  • Acoustic Performance: The primary benefit is, of course, improved acoustics. By absorbing sound, these panels reduce echo and reverberation, creating a more comfortable and productive environment. This is particularly important in spaces where clear communication is essential, such as offices, classrooms, and conference rooms.
  • Aesthetic Versatility: Softboard panels are available in a wide range of colors, shapes, and sizes. They can be easily customized to match the aesthetic of any space. Many manufacturers offer options for printing custom designs or patterns directly onto the panels, allowing for seamless integration with existing decor.
  • Sustainability: Many softboard panels are made from recycled or sustainably sourced materials, making them an environmentally friendly choice. The use of natural fibers also contributes to a healthier indoor environment, as they are typically low in volatile organic compounds (VOCs).
  • Ease of Installation: Softboard panels are relatively easy to install, requiring minimal tools and expertise. They can be mounted directly to walls or ceilings using adhesives, screws, or suspension systems. This makes them a cost-effective solution for both new construction and renovation projects.
  • Durability: Despite their lightweight nature, softboard panels are surprisingly durable. They can withstand everyday wear and tear and are resistant to impact damage. This makes them a long-lasting solution for high-traffic areas.
  • Thermal Insulation: In addition to acoustic benefits, softboard panels can also provide a degree of thermal insulation. This can help to reduce energy consumption by keeping spaces warmer in the winter and cooler in the summer.

Choosing the Right Softboard Panels

Selecting the appropriate softboard panels requires careful consideration of several factors:

Acoustic Performance

The most important factor is the acoustic performance of the panel. This is typically measured by the Noise Reduction Coefficient (NRC), which indicates the percentage of sound absorbed by the panel. A higher NRC value indicates better sound absorption. Consider the specific acoustic requirements of your space and choose panels with an NRC rating that meets those needs. Panel Thickness and Density

Thicker and denser panels generally provide better sound absorption. However, they may also be more expensive and heavier. Consider the trade-offs between acoustic performance, cost, and weight when making your selection.

Material and Sustainability

Choose softboard panels made from recycled or sustainably sourced materials. This will minimize your environmental impact and ensure that you are using a product that is both eco-friendly and healthy. Look for certifications such as FSC (Forest Stewardship Council) or Greenguard to ensure that the panels meet stringent environmental standards.

Aesthetic Considerations

Select softboard panels that complement the aesthetic of your space. Consider the color, shape, size, and texture of the panels. Many manufacturers offer custom design options, allowing you to create panels that perfectly match your vision.

Installation Method

Consider the installation method when choosing softboard panels. Some panels are designed for direct mounting to walls or ceilings, while others require a suspension system. Choose a method that is appropriate for your space and skill level.

Cost

Softboard panels vary in price depending on their size, thickness, material, and acoustic performance. Set a budget and choose panels that meet your needs without breaking the bank. Remember to factor in the cost of installation when calculating the total cost of the project.

Installation Tips for Softboard Panels

Proper installation is crucial for maximizing the acoustic benefits of softboard panels. Here are some tips to ensure a successful installation:

  • Prepare the Surface: Ensure that the surface is clean, dry, and free of debris before installing the panels.
  • Use the Right Adhesive: Choose an adhesive that is specifically designed for use with softboard panels. Follow the manufacturer’s instructions carefully.
  • Measure Accurately: Measure the space carefully and cut the panels to the correct size. Use a sharp utility knife or saw for clean cuts.
  • Apply Even Pressure: When installing the panels, apply even pressure to ensure that they are securely attached to the surface.
  • Consider Air Gaps: In some cases, creating a small air gap behind the panels can improve their acoustic performance. This can be achieved by using furring strips or standoffs.
